This repository contains a simple web application for taking notes, built with Node.js (Express, EJS, Marked) and MongoDB. It demonstrates a structured approach to project organization, separating application source code, containerization assets, and Kubernetes deployment manifests into distinct directories.
This project is organized into three main directories to clearly separate different aspects of the application's lifecycle and deployment:
This directory holds the core Node.js application logic, including:
-
index.js: The main Express server. -
package.json / package-lock.json: Node.js project dependencies. -
views/: EJS templates for the user interface. -
public/: Static assets like CSS and a placeholder for user uploads (uploads/). -
Purpose: This is the standalone, runnable application code. It focuses purely on the functionality of the note-taking app.
This directory contains all files necessary to containerize the 01-code application using Docker:
Dockerfile: Instructions to build the Docker image for the Node.js application.
Purpose: To package the application into lightweight, portable Docker containers, making it easy to run consistently across different environments.
This directory houses the YAML manifest files required to deploy and manage the containerized application and its MongoDB database on a Kubernetes cluster:
k8s-manifests.yaml: Defines Kubernetes objects like Deployments, Services, PersistentVolumeClaims, and Secrets for MongoDB and the Node.js app.
Purpose: To orchestrate the application's deployment, scaling, and management in a production-like Kubernetes environment.
This separation enhances modularity, maintainability, and clarity, allowing different teams or deployment strategies to focus on their respective concerns without intermingling files.
